Spokane has four distinct seasons, averaging 44 inches of snow during the winter, and 80–90 degree temperatures during the hottest summer months.

The Spokane-CDA region is known for abundant recreation.

• In spring, summer, and fall: Explore hiking trails and swim, float, kayak, paddleboard, and fish in the beautiful lakes and rivers in the Spokane-CDA area. (1) Spokane River, (2) Lake Coeur d'Alene, (3) Lake Pend Oreille, (4) Priest Lake, and (5) St. Joe River.

• In winter: Enjoy fresh powder, majestic mountain views, skiing, snowboarding, snowshoeing, and tubing at five resorts in the Spokane-CDA area. (1) Mt. Spokane, (2) 49 Degrees North, (3) Schweitzer Mountain, (4) Silver Mountain, and (5) Lookout Pass.

Located in one of Spokane's South Hill private upscale neighborhoods on a mountain just beyond the southeast edge of the City of Spokane. The neighborhood is entirely residential and its location on the hillside gives the houses panoramic views of the South Hill, Palouse, West Plains including the tower at Spokane International Airport, and the Selkirk Mountains to the north and northwest of the city.

The best way to get to and from the property and around the area is by car. An all-wheel-drive vehicle is necessary during seasonal weather. Snow during winter is likely. Expect occasional mud during rain or after thaw. Fall and winter seasons bring breezy weather and snow fall. The private road and private driveway are plowed when there is snow.
